Petro Atlético kicked off their CAF Champions League campaign with a narrow 1–0 victory over Simba SC in Dar es Salaam on Sunday.
The Tanzanian side bossed possession for long stretches in the opening half.
Yet, their control rarely translated into real danger for the visitors.
Petro’s patience finally paid off in the 78th minute.
Benny finished from close range after Tiago Reis sparked a neat passage of play that unlocked the Simba back line.
Simba reacted with multiple substitutions as they chased a late response, but Petro’s defensive discipline held firm.
With the win, and the draw between Espérance and Stade Malien earlier in the day, Petro move straight to the top of Group D.
It gives the Angolan champions an early advantage in what is expected to be a fiercely competitive Champions League group.
